Shell歷史命令

2021-07-23 16:54:19 字數 718 閱讀 8325

1.歷史命令

history:輸出的是我上次.bash_history儲存下來的和我這次輸入的命令。

歷史命令實際儲存在使用者家目錄下的檔案中:~/.bash_history

開啟該檔案:cat .bash_history,這裡面儲存的是我上次登陸正確登出後儲存的命令。

這次登陸正確退出的時候才會把命令同步到.bash_history中。

所以用history輸出的命令比.bash_history中儲存的命令多。

可以將這次輸入的命令強制寫入.bash_history指令是:history -w

如果不是特別必要,不用清空歷史命令。因為一是排錯。二是發現入侵者。

/etc/profile中配置了歷史命令最大條數。

常用的歷史命令呼叫上下箭頭和!字串

快捷鍵:tab鍵自動補全,可以加快輸入速度和排錯。

shell 歷史命令記錄功能

標籤 空格分隔 linux shell 在 linux 下面可以使用history命令檢視使用者的所有歷史操作,同時 shell 命令操作記錄預設儲存在使用者目錄的.bash history檔案中。通過這個檔案可以查詢 shell 命令的執行歷史,有助於運維人員進行系統審計和問題排查,同時在伺服器遭...

shell 歷史命令相關記錄

shell 歷史命令使用上有很多技巧,除了經常經常使用的 fc l history shell ls bin sh shell file 是對歷史命令引數的直接引用 再來看乙個長點的。這顯然是乙個錯誤的輸入,大家都知道bz2是使用bzip解壓縮的,對應的tar引數,應當是使用 jxvf 那我們可以立...

shell歷史命令記錄功能

在linux下可通過history命令檢視使用者所有的歷史操作記錄,同時shell命令操作記錄預設儲存在使用者目錄下的.bash history檔案中,通過這個檔案可以查詢shell命令的執行歷史,有助於運維人員進行系統審計和問題排查,同事,在伺服器遭受黑客攻擊後,也可以通過這個命令或檔案查詢黑客登...